About Revel
Revel is building the software infrastructure that controls the world's most critical hardware systems — across aerospace, energy, robotics, defense, and advanced manufacturing. Our platform replaces outdated tooling with a modern, high-performance stack for commanding, monitoring, and deploying real-world systems. Engineers rely on Revel to operate hardware where safety, speed, reliability, and clarity matter. As we scale, we are tackling complex data challenges around ingesting and analyzing large volumes of high-frequency, high-cardinality telemetry.

Role Overview
We are hiring a Senior Backend Engineer to help build the systems that power our data platform. This role focuses on designing and implementing backend services and data pipelines that handle large-scale industrial telemetry. The nature of this data — high volume, high frequency, and high cardinality — requires thoughtful system design beyond typical off-the-shelf solutions.

You will work on high-performance services in Rust, help shape our data architecture, and contribute to the evolution of our infrastructure as we expand toward more cloud-based systems. Your work will directly support core product capabilities, including reporting, analytics, and real-time system visibility.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
